小程序怎么导入模块表 小程序怎么导入模块表格文件
在微信小程序中,导入模块(通常指的是引入其他文件或库)是一个常见的操作,它允许开发者重用代码和模块化开发,以下是如何在微信小程序中导入模块表(即数据表)的步骤:
1、创建模块文件:
你需要有一个模块文件,这个文件可以是一个JSON文件,也可以是一个JavaScript文件,你可以创建一个名为data.js
的文件,里面定义了一个模块表。
```javascript
// data.js
const moduleTable = {
// 模块表的数据
key1: 'value1',
key2: 'value2',
// 更多数据...
};
module.exports = moduleTable;
```
2、在需要的地方导入模块:
在你需要使用这个模块表的页面或组件的JavaScript文件中,使用require
或import
语句来导入。
使用require
(CommonJS模块规范):
```javascript
// page.js
const moduleTable = require('../../path/to/data.js');
Page({
data: {
// 页面的初始数据
},
onLoad: function() {
// 使用模块表中的数据
console.log(moduleTable.key1); // 输出 'value1'
}
});
```
使用import
(ES6模块规范):
```javascript
// page.js
import moduleTable from '../../path/to/data.js';
Page({
data: {
// 页面的初始数据
},
onLoad: function() {
// 使用模块表中的数据
console.log(moduleTable.key1); // 输出 'value1'
}
});
```
注意:路径需要根据你的项目结构进行调整。
3、使用模块表中的数据:
一旦导入了模块表,你就可以在小程序的任何地方使用其中的数据了。
4、注意事项:
- 确保模块文件的路径正确,否则会导致导入失败。
- 如果你的模块表非常大,可能需要考虑性能和加载时间,在这种情况下,可以考虑将数据存储在云开发数据库中,并通过API调用获取。
- 微信小程序对文件大小有限制,单个文件不能超过1MB,如果模块表非常大,可能需要分割成多个文件或者使用其他存储方式。
5、模块化的好处:
- 代码复用:模块化可以让你在多个页面或组件中重用同一份数据。
- 维护性:模块化代码更容易维护和更新。
- 可测试性:模块化的代码更容易编写单元测试。
通过以上步骤,你可以在微信小程序中成功导入并使用模块表,这不仅可以帮助你组织代码,还可以提高开发效率和代码质量。
还没有评论,来说两句吧...